| 36 | /** |
| 37 | * G_DBUS_METHOD_INVOCATION_HANDLED: |
| 38 | * |
| 39 | * The value returned by handlers of the signals generated by |
| 40 | * the `gdbus-codegen` tool to indicate that a method call has been |
| 41 | * handled by an implementation. It is equal to %TRUE, but using |
| 42 | * this macro is sometimes more readable. |
| 43 | * |
| 44 | * In code that needs to be backwards-compatible with older GLib, |
| 45 | * use %TRUE instead, often written like this: |
| 46 | * |
| 47 | * |[ |
| 48 | * g_dbus_method_invocation_return_error (invocation, ...); |
| 49 | * return TRUE; // handled |
| 50 | * ]| |
| 51 | * |
| 52 | * Since: 2.68 |
| 53 | */ |
| 54 | #define G_DBUS_METHOD_INVOCATION_HANDLED TRUE GLIB_AVAILABLE_MACRO_IN_2_68 |
| 55 | |
| 56 | /** |
| 57 | * G_DBUS_METHOD_INVOCATION_UNHANDLED: |
| 58 | * |
| 59 | * The value returned by handlers of the signals generated by |
| 60 | * the `gdbus-codegen` tool to indicate that a method call has not been |
| 61 | * handled by an implementation. It is equal to %FALSE, but using |
| 62 | * this macro is sometimes more readable. |
| 63 | * |
| 64 | * In code that needs to be backwards-compatible with older GLib, |
| 65 | * use %FALSE instead. |
| 66 | * |
| 67 | * Since: 2.68 |
| 68 | */ |
| 69 | #define G_DBUS_METHOD_INVOCATION_UNHANDLED FALSE GLIB_AVAILABLE_MACRO_IN_2_68 |
